The station is equipped with a range of facilities designed to make your journey as comfortable and easy as possible. Ticket buying and collection are straightforward with both a ticket office and machines available. Accessibility is a key focus with step-free access provided in parts and ramps available for train access. While the station does not have a luggage storage facility, it excels in providing essential services like CCTV for security and a help point for customer information. For those relying on the digital world, while Wi-Fi isn't available, pay phones are on hand if you need to make a call.
And if you're peckish or fancy a caffeine boost, there's a coffee shop right on site. However, note that while smartcards can be issued, there are no smartcard validators, and for the currency-conscious, no ATMs or currency exchange services are available.
Torquay Train Station aims to ensure that everyone can access rail services confidently. This is achieved through features such as step-free access to all platforms, acc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and a designated set-down/pick-up point for those with impaired mobility. While there are no accessible toilets, assistance can still be arranged by contacting the helpline in advance via Passenger Assist.
When it comes to onward travel, the station connects smoothly with various other forms of transport. If you're thinking about continuing your journey by bus, printed information for planning your trip is readily available (here). Taxis are readily accessible just outside the station, and for those looking to hire a vehicle, there's a Thrifty Car hire service right adjacent to platform 1. Bicycle hire might be less accessible, with limited storage and no shelter, but the station ensures there are standards for bike parking if needed.

Crowhurst Station may be small, but it serves the needs of its passengers efficiently. The station's ticket office operates from 06:00 to 10:00 on weekdays, with automatic machines available for purchasing and collecting tickets both online and at the station. Do note that smartcards are not issued or validated here, although traditional paper tickets are fully supported.
Facilities for those requiring assistance are thoughtfully provided. While full step-free access isn't available, platform 1 does offer it for those heading towards London, complete with accessible ticket machines stationed there. A help point is available for any on-the-go assistance, and station staff are present during ticket office hours to aid where necessary. CCTV is operational for enhanced security, bringing peace of mind to passengers awaiting trains. The station holds a Secure Station accreditation, demonstrating its commitment to passenger safety and security.
Travelling beyond Crowhurst is a breeze, with excellent transport links to and from the station. A conveniently located bus stop just outside serves as a pickup and drop-off point for rail replacement services when needed. For those planning further journeys, a printable guide is available here, offering essential information for hopping onto connecting services.
